Business Intelligence Tools started the same way with limited capability, nice pretty pictures and detail about what has already happened. Now they are evolving into decision making platforms that can help plan, forecast, predict and integrate data from Finance, Operations (including IOT) and lot’s of external Information sources.
Today’s successful companies have a common theme …. their success has come through ’embracing systems and technology’ and the key word there is ‘systems’. For many years now companies have implemented ‘systems’ for finance and accounting, HR, Payroll, Supply Chain, CRM etc. However, when it comes to Reporting, Forecasting, Budgeting, Planning, arguably the most important aspect of a business, they are reliant on a plethora of spreadsheets and ad-hoc reporting tools with no regulated, controlled or integrated single source of the truth in terms of the data.
